Kolín – letiště, Natural monument near Pašinka, Czech Republic.
Kolín airport natural monument near Pašinka comprises grasslands and meadows that host a range of plant and animal species. The area is accessible via marked trails with informational signage that describes the local ecological features.
The site gained official protection status in 2012 when it was designated as a natural monument. This recognition reflected efforts to safeguard the area's ecological diversity for future generations.
The site functions as a learning space where visitors can observe native plants and animals in their natural setting. Walking through the grasslands gives a sense of how local ecosystems work and why such areas matter for the region.
The best access is from Pašinka village via the marked pathways that guide you through the area. The grasslands are walkable year-round, though spring and summer offer the best opportunity to observe the full range of plants in bloom.
The protected zone features specific soil types that allow rare plant species to thrive, plants that are found in only a few other locations across the Czech Republic. These distinctive soil conditions make the grasslands particularly valuable for nature enthusiasts and plant experts.
